Output 3d56c4d37e5e832d899254af1aa3237c587702e9c3649269e821d0b4dbb0631b:9

value
2431106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8fe3764df4e9110c5d6042c9947039d0aa08957 OP_EQUAL
address
3QPa3P66efe1WnxrACs3D3jzWkpdWCzCny
transaction
3d56c4d37e5e832d899254af1aa3237c587702e9c3649269e821d0b4dbb0631b
spent
true